Car Key Battery Replacement

toyota-logo-2020.pngIf your car key fob isn't working, it could be due to a low or dead battery. It is simple to replace a car keyfob battery at home.

First, check what type of battery your device requires. A lot of them are CR2025 or 3-Volt batteries, which can be purchased at hardware stores and other electronic retailers.

Modern cars are equipped with key fobs, which have a separate battery. The most popular replacement for the car key battery is the CR2032, which can be found in shops such as Batteries Plus.

To change the batteries in your key fob you will have to open it. Most key fobs feature an elongated design, which has two halves that snap together. Most of the time, you can open up the key fob with an ice cream knife or fingernail. However, some are more secure and will require a screwdriver to pry apart.

After the two halves have been separated the circuit board and battery can be observed. Be careful not to lose any screws or wires in this process. Take a photo or write down the location of the battery that was used in the key fob so that you can replace it in the same way.

After removing the battery that was used, simply insert a new one in the same place. Be sure to check that the new battery has both a positive and negative side. Once the battery is installed and plugged in, you can put the circuit board over it and snap back the two halves together.

First, you'll need to open the fob that holds the key. This procedure varies from manufacturer to manufacturer, but generally you'll require an flat screwdriver or a sturdy fingernail to pull the fob apart at the seam. You must be cautious to avoid damaging any internal components while opening your key fob.

Once you have the fob open, remove the battery that was in it. It should be able to pop out easily due to the spring built into the fob, but if not try using more than one place around the fob and apply gentle pressure. Install the new battery into its compartment, and make sure it is placed in the correct position.

You can find the button cell battery in most auto accessory stores as well as home improvement stores and general stores. You can also buy them from online retailers like Amazon.

You'll need close your key fob a second time after replacing the battery. It's a good idea to test the lock and unlock and start functions to ensure they're functioning correctly. If you notice that they're not working, it could be beneficial to have the key fob programmed by a locksmith.
